1. What Equipment Do I Need To Play Just Dance On PS4?
To dive into the world of Just Dance on your PS4, you essentially have two options for motion tracking: using the PlayStation Camera or using the Just Dance Controller App on your smartphone. Either way, you’ll need a copy of the Just Dance game for PS4.
PlayStation Camera:
- Pros: Accurate motion tracking, no need for smartphones.
- Cons: Requires an additional purchase if you don’t already own one.
Just Dance Controller App:
- Pros: Accessible; most people already own a smartphone.
- Cons: Relies on the phone’s accelerometer and gyroscope, which may be less accurate than the PlayStation Camera.
- Note: Ensure your smartphone meets the app’s compatibility requirements.
2. How Do I Set Up Just Dance On My PS4?
Setting up Just Dance on your PS4 is straightforward, and you can quickly get ready to dance. Here’s a breakdown of the setup process, covering both the PlayStation Camera and the smartphone app methods:
With PlayStation Camera:
- Connect the Camera: Plug the PlayStation Camera into the AUX port on the back of your PS4.
- Position the Camera: Place the camera on a stable surface, ensuring it has a clear view of the play area.
- Turn on the PS4: Power on your PlayStation 4 console.
- Insert the Game Disc or Download the Game: Put the Just Dance game disc into your PS4, or download the game from the PlayStation Store if you purchased it digitally.
- Calibrate the Camera: Follow the on-screen instructions to calibrate the PlayStation Camera for optimal motion tracking. This usually involves standing in the play area and making specific movements.

4. How Does Scoring Work In Just Dance On PS4?
In Just Dance on PS4, scoring is based on how accurately you mimic the on-screen dancer’s moves. The more precise your movements, the higher your score. Here’s a detailed breakdown of the scoring system:
-
Movement Tracking:
- PlayStation Camera: If you’re using the PlayStation Camera, it tracks your full body movements to determine how well you match the on-screen dancer.
- Just Dance Controller App: If you’re using the Just Dance Controller App, it tracks the movement of your right hand, which holds your smartphone. While less precise than full body tracking, it still effectively captures the rhythm and basic movements.
-
Scoring Levels:
- The game provides real-time feedback on your performance through different scoring levels:
- X: Indicates that the movement was completely missed or not recognized.
- OK: Indicates a weak or inaccurate movement.
- GOOD: Indicates a decent attempt with some accuracy.
- SUPER: Indicates a strong and accurate movement.
- PERFECT: Indicates a near-perfect match to the on-screen dancer’s move.
- The game provides real-time feedback on your performance through different scoring levels:
-
Stars and Points:
- Your performance is also rated with stars at the end of each song:
- 1 Star: Low score, indicating significant room for improvement.
- 2 Stars: Average score, showing some accuracy in your movements.
- 3 Stars: Good score, indicating a solid performance.
- 4 Stars: High score, showing excellent accuracy and rhythm.
- 5 Stars: Excellent score, indicating near-perfect execution of the dance routine.
- Megastar: The highest achievable rating, earned by scoring over 11,000 points, indicating exceptional performance.
- Your performance is also rated with stars at the end of each song:
-
Combos and Streaks:
- Maintaining a streak of accurate moves earns you combo bonuses, which significantly increase your score. Missing a move breaks the combo.
-
Gold Moves:
- Some songs feature special “Gold Moves” that are highlighted on the screen. These moves are more complex and offer a higher score bonus if executed correctly.
-
Scoring Metrics:
- Accuracy: How closely your movements match the on-screen dancer.
- Timing: Executing moves at the right moment in sync with the music.
- Energy: The enthusiasm and energy you put into your dance.
-
Maximum Score:
- The maximum score you can achieve in a song is typically around 13,000 points. Achieving this score requires a combination of accurate moves, maintaining combos, and hitting Gold Moves.

8. Are There Any Common Issues When Playing Just Dance On PS4 And How Can I Fix Them?
Playing Just Dance on PS4 can sometimes come with technical hiccups. Here are some common issues and how to troubleshoot them:
-
Tracking Issues:
- Problem: The game isn’t accurately tracking your movements.
- Solutions:
- Adjust Camera Position: Ensure the PlayStation Camera is properly positioned and has a clear view of the play area.
- Calibrate Camera: Recalibrate the camera through the game’s settings menu.
- Lighting Conditions: Make sure the room is well-lit, but avoid direct sunlight or glare, which can interfere with tracking.
- Controller App: If using the Just Dance Controller App, ensure your smartphone is securely held in your right hand and that the app is properly connected to the PS4.
- Restart App: Restart the Just Dance Controller App on your smartphone.
-
Connectivity Issues:
- Problem: Difficulty connecting to online services, such as World Dance Floor or Just Dance Unlimited.
- Solutions:
- Check Internet Connection: Ensure your PS4 is connected to the internet and that your connection is stable.
- Restart Router: Restart your home router to refresh the network connection.
- PlayStation Network Status: Check the PlayStation Network status to see if there are any server issues.
- Firewall Settings: Ensure that Just Dance is not being blocked by your firewall settings.
-
Subscription Issues:
- Problem: Just Dance Unlimited subscription not recognized.
- Solutions:
- Verify Subscription: Check your PlayStation Network account to ensure that your Just Dance Unlimited subscription is active.
- Restore Licenses: Restore licenses through the PS4 settings menu (Settings > Account Management > Restore Licenses).
- Restart Game: Restart Just Dance to refresh the subscription status.
- Contact Support: If the issue persists, contact PlayStation Support for assistance.
-
Game Freezing or Crashing:
- Problem: The game freezes or crashes during gameplay.
- Solutions:
- Close Other Applications: Close any other applications running in the background to free up system resources.
- Restart PS4: Restart your PS4 to clear the system cache.
- Update Game: Ensure that Just Dance is updated to the latest version.
- Reinstall Game: If the issue persists, try reinstalling the game.
-
Audio Issues:
- Problem: No audio or distorted audio during gameplay.
- Solutions:
- Check Volume Levels: Ensure that the volume levels are properly adjusted on your TV and PS4.
- Audio Settings: Check the audio settings in the game menu to ensure the correct output device is selected.
- Headphones: If using headphones, make sure they are properly connected and that the volume is turned up.
- Update System Software: Ensure your PS4 system software is up to date.
-
Controller Issues:
- Problem: DualShock 4 controller not working properly.
- Solutions:
- Charge Controller: Ensure the controller is properly charged.
- Resync Controller: Resync the controller with the PS4 by connecting it with a USB cable.
- Restart PS4: Restart the PS4 to refresh the controller connection.
-
Installation Issues:
- Problem: Problems installing the game.
- Solutions:
- Enough storage: Make sure you have enough storage to install the game.
- Check the disc: Make sure there are no scratches on the disc.
- Internet: Ensure you have enough internet to download the game.
